What is a Designated Agent?

A official agent is a specific person or organization that serves as the primary point of contact for a corporation, such as an Limited Liability Company or business corporation. This agent is responsible for receiving vital legal documents, such as service of process, tax notices, and law-related correspondence from the government. The role of a registered agent is crucial for guaranteeing that a business remains informed about legal matters and maintains good standing with state authorities.

The requirement for a registered agent is established by local regulations, which mandate that every registered business must appoint one to ensure proper interaction between the company and the local government. The registered agent must have a physical address in the jurisdiction where the business is formed and be accessible during standard business hours. This ensures that important documents can be safely delivered and received in a prompt fashion.

Using a professional registered agent service offers various benefits. Not only do these services provide a dependable means of handling crucial legal documents, but they also help maintain privacy for business owners by keeping their personal addresses off the public domain. Additionally, numerous registered agent services provide legal alerts and support, making it easier for businesses to adhere to legal requirements and deadlines.

Expense Aspects for Designated Agents

As reviewing official agent solutions, grasping the cost implications is important for all business owner. Costs can fluctuate significantly based on factors such as the category of organization and the services provided. On average, the cost of engaging a designated agent can vary from $50 to five hundred dollars per year, based on whether you are selecting for minimal services or a full package. This consideration is particularly noteworthy for Limited Liability Companies and companies, as they have particular legal requirements that must be fulfilled.

Registered Agent Duties

A registered agent serves as a vital link between a company and the state, ensuring crucial documents are received and handled appropriately. One key responsibility is to receive legal documents on behalf of the business, including process service, tax communications, and compliance communications. This service is essential for maintaining the legal standing of a business entity, whether it is an LLC or a corporation.

Another significant responsibility of a registered agent involves maintaining up-to-date contact information and being available during regular hours. This guarantees that crucial notifications are obtained in a prompt manner, preventing potential legal consequences. Companies that fail to have a reliable registered agent may face fines or even involuntary dissolution due to missed communications.

Furthermore, a designated agent plays a key role in ensuring compliance with local regulations. This includes keeping track of submission due dates for annual reports and other required documents. By fulfilling these responsibilities, a registered agent helps businesses avoid regulatory problems and maintain good standing with government officials, allowing owners to focus on their main activities rather than bureaucratic burdens.
